			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Web Browser Firefox 3 is out today, but it&#8217;s been the victim of its own success, as the main web servers that should allow you to download this browser have been overloaded. The plan was to have a record-breaking number of downloads of the web browser today, but it seems that everyone&#8217;s trying to grab it all at the same time, as it was not &#8216;rolled out&#8217; as midnight hit around the world, but went live, everywhere, at the same time. or rather, failed to go live. Oops.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.mozilla-europe.org/en/firefox/"><img src="http://img.skitch.com/20080617-te8p2ss2716b5epfb2j2e2p17u.jpg" alt="Firefox web browser | Faster, more secure, &amp; customizable | Mozilla Europe" vspace="20" hspace="20"/></a></p>
<p>A number of mirror sites allow one to use FTP transfer to download Firefox, but for the less technical (and for those worried that their download won&#8217;t count in the record-breaking attempt) this is not what they want. Help is at hand, as, the European site is definitely live and kicking, so you can <a href="http://www.mozilla-europe.org/en/firefox/">grab the Firefox Browser there now</a>. I&#8217;ve been using the browser for just over an hour, and find it quick, compatible with my key add-ins, and stable.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>My friend <a href="http://bomega.com">Boris Veldhuijzen van Zanten</a>, who also organises the <a href="http://2009.thenextweb.org">Next Web Conference</a>, is always coming up with brilliant ideas, and then making them work online. His latest idea is already proving to be popular. </p>
<p><a href="http://Twittercounter.com">Twittercounter</a> lets you show off the number of Twitter followers you have.<br />
<a href="http://twittercounter.com/?username=clarocada" title="TwitterCounter for @clarocada"><img src="http://twittercounter.com/counter/?username=clarocada" width="88" height="26" border="0" alt="TwitterCounter for @clarocada" hspace="2-" vspace="20" align=right /></a><br />
You just type in your Twitter username at twittercounter.com and copy and paste the code that appears into your web site or blog, and you have the perfect way to brag about how many people hold on to your every word. Boris explains some of the rationale behind the growing importance of twitter followers at <a href="http://thenextweb.org/2008/06/12/twittercounter-feedburner-for-twitter/">The Next Web Blog</a> - and notes the very important fact that a twitter feed is also a great way for people to follow a blog. So Twitter is more like the new RSS feed, which is itself the new page hit count.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>I&#8217;m currently in the break-out area for The Next Web at Westergasfabriek <a href="http://2008.thenextweb.org">The Next Web Conference</a>, for which registration opens in about 30 minutes. I am here early to grab a few interviews while people are still working out whether I&#8217;m worth speaking to or not&#8230;</strong></p>
<p>And you know - I&#8217;m excited. There&#8217;s a buzz already in the hotel yesterday where a lot of delegates are camped, and a few gatherings have already taken place - an ebuddy party and a pownce people meetup to name just two. I of course stayed in with my slippers and pipe, a chocomel and my rss reader. A local free newspaper had an article about QR codes on Wednesday, which made me smile, as I&#8217;ve had 400 stickers made up which show a QR code that links to this blog - and have absolutely no other identifying markings.</p>

<p>The tenth in a series of Ten Top Tips to make your online profile work harder than you do&#8230; <br />
Tip 10: Call to action</p>
<p>If you don&#8217;t ask people to do things - guess what - they don&#8217;t do anything. So remember that if you want people to contact you or buy from you or talk to you - you need to ask them to do it. </p>
<p>Your online profile is your first, and often your last chance, to make a positive and credible impression online. It&#8217;s a combination of a sales pitch, a personal presentation, a business card, a brochure, a personal statement, a list of recommendations, a mini web-site, and a wave from across the room. It has a lot of work to do.</p>

<p>The ninth in a series of Ten Top Tips to make your online profile work harder than you do&#8230; <br />
Tip 9: Talk to strangers</p>
<p>Yes. Talk to strangers before you commit your profile to the digital winds. Ask people who perhaps don&#8217;t know you all that well to look at what you&#8217;ve drafted - and they&#8217;ll tell you where it&#8217;s good, and bad. Better to find out now, than later&#8230;</p>
